What shoes to wear with blue dress — by style and occasion

Casual daytime: sneakers, sandals, and espadrilles

For an easy, street-chic vibe, pair a light blue or chambray dress with white sneakers or canvas trainers. This “sneakers with dress” combo is perfect for brunch, errands, or travel. For warmer days, strappy flat sandals or espadrille wedges in neutral tones (tan, beige, or white) elevate the look without feeling overdressed. Office-friendly: loafers, low pumps, and mules

If you’re wearing a knee-length navy or cobalt sheath to work, choose closed-toe pumps in nude or black for polish. Block-heel pumps and leather mules are professional and comfortable alternatives. For a modern twist, leather loafers in deep brown or navy keep things smart and wearable.

Date night and cocktail: heels and strappy sandals

For evening looks, heels are your best friend. Metallic gold or silver strappy sandals bring instant glamour to a royal blue or cobalt cocktail dress. Nude stilettos elongate the leg and let a bold blue dress shine. If you want to be fashion-forward, consider jewel-toned shoes (emerald, burgundy) for an eye-catching contrast.

Wedding guest or formal event: elegant neutrals and metallics

For weddings, choose classic options: nude pumps, champagne metallic heels, or embellished sandals. Navy dresses pair beautifully with rose gold or pewter shoes. Keep comfort in mind — a cushioned insole or a slightly lower heel will keep you on the dance floor longer.

Fall and winter: boots and booties

Midi and maxi blue dresses look fabulous with ankle boots or knee-high boots. For navy or deep blue shades, try black leather boots for a streamlined look. Suede booties in cognac or chocolate add warmth to lighter blue dresses. Pro tip: consider hosiery and a pedicure color that complements the shoe (nude or deep berry).

Color rules: what color shoes to wear with a blue dress

Choosing the right color is the most important decision. Here are foolproof pairings:

  • Nude/beige: universal and leg-lengthening for almost any blue shade.
  • White: fresh and modern with light or pastel blues.
  • Black: classic and chic, ideal for navy or darker blues.
  • Metallics (gold, silver, pewter): dressy options that add shine.
  • Bold color contrast: mustard, burgundy, or emerald for a fashion-forward statement.

Practical tips on shoe silhouettes and proportions

  • Longer dresses: balance volume with sleeker shoes (strappy sandals, pointed pumps).
  • Shorter dresses: ankle straps and block heels ground the look and provide stability.
  • Flared skirts: avoid clunky shoes that compete with the skirt’s movement — go for delicate straps or streamlined flats.
  • Consider foot shape: pointed toes elongate, round toes feel more comfortable for wider feet.

Accessories, pedicure colors, and finishing touches

  • Match metals: if your shoes are gold, add gold jewelry or a clutch for cohesion.
  • Pedicure: nude, pale pink, or matching blue tones work well; metallic nail polish is a chic choice with metallic shoes.
  • Bag size: for heels, opt for a small clutch; for casual sneakers, choose a crossbody or tote.

Real-world fashion advice: comfort, budget, and sustainability

Never sacrifice comfort for style — padded insoles, lower heels, or wedges make long days manageable. Invest in one or two timeless pairs (nude pumps, metallic sandals) and mix them with seasonal finds. If sustainability matters to you, look for leather alternatives or secondhand shoes from reputable sellers.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I wear white sneakers with a blue dress?

Absolutely. White sneakers give a fresh, casual look to light blue or denim dresses and work well for daytime outings or travel. Pair with a crossbody bag and minimal jewelry for an effortless finish.

2. What color heels go best with a navy dress for a wedding?

Nude or metallic heels (gold, champagne, or silver) are classic choices for navy dresses at weddings. They keep the outfit elegant and allow accessories to shine. If you prefer color, deep burgundy or emerald can add a sophisticated pop.

3. Are boots appropriate with a blue midi dress?

Yes — ankle boots or knee-high boots are great with midi dresses, especially in fall and winter. Choose sleeker boots for a polished look or chunky booties for an edgy, modern feel. Match boot color to your tights or bag to create cohesion.
